>> Hi, I'm Matthew Moskovciak, Assistant Editor at CNET and this is the LGVH100. As it's the first player that can play both HD dvd's and Blue Ray disks, which gives it the title the Super Multi Blue Player. As you can see from the design, there's no buttons on the front of the unit. They're actually on the top. The buttons themselves are touch sensitive which we usually have a problem with but these actually worked perfectly fine. And the remote itself is, it's actually pretty good. It's better than most of the other players that we've seen and there's good button differentiation. We had no problem navigating just by holding it. If you look around back, you can see the connectivity of the unit and the most important part is the HD My Port which can output HD dvd's and Blue Ray disks up to 1080P. There's also a component video output and there's both optical and coaxial digital audio outputs. This player does not fully support all of the HD dvd functions. Most importantly, it lacks HDI functionality. That means that some of the menus and interactive features of HD dvd won't actually work on this player. In the same vein, the soundtrack support isn't 100% great, particularly the high resolution audio soundtracks will only output and dial down Dolby digital mode or DTS mode. Standard Dolby digital mode, over the HDMI output. In terms of performance, we really liked the image quality on both Blue Ray and HD dvd disks. Overall the LGVH100 is a pretty good unit and we love the fact that it can play both HD dvd's and Blue Ray disks, but some of the limited functionality and missing features is probably going to limit it's appeal to early adopters. LG BH100 Review

Editors' rating

The good: Plays back both HD DVD and Blu-ray discs; excellent image quality on both high-def disc formats; attractive design with touch-sensitive buttons; excellent remote; quick response during scans and chapter skips.

The bad: Expensive; no CD playback; subpar support for new surround soundtracks; does not support HDi interactive features of HD DVDs; only a few TVs can't accept its type of 1080p output; upscaling of DVDs is a step below competitors; load times are somewhat slow.

The bottom line: The LG BH100 can play back both HD DVD and Blu-ray discs with excellent image quality, but a variety of quirks and missing features limits its appeal.
